The accumulation of dot balls not only restricts scoring but also increases the risk of losing wickets as batters try to force the pace. This creates a negative cycle where pressure mounts, leading to rash shots and ultimately, dismissals. Analyzing the dot ball percentage in various phases of the game can provide valuable insights into the batting approach of both teams. It can also highlight specific areas where batters need to improve, such as strike rotation techniques and finding gaps in the field.
Several factors contribute to a high dot ball count, including tight bowling, effective field placements, and batters' inability to find scoring opportunities. Bowlers who can consistently hit good lengths and maintain accuracy can stifle the scoring rate and build pressure. Fielders placed strategically in the gaps can cut off easy singles and doubles, further frustrating the batters. To combat this, batters need to develop a wider range of scoring shots and improve their ability to rotate the strike. Quick singles, smart placement, and aggressive running between the wickets can help alleviate the pressure and keep the scoreboard moving.
